With the highly-prized rookie card of Hall of Famer Ken Dryden leading the way, the clean and colorful 1971-72 Topps hockey set contains only 132 cards but is packed with Hall of Famers like Phil Esposito, Bobby Hull, Gordie Howe, Bobby Orr, Henri Richard, and Stan Mikita. The featured complete assemblage ranks #18 on the PSA Set Registry with an impressive 8.32 set rating with 42 cards graded PSA 9, most notably #70 Howe, 114 Clarke, and 120 H. Richard with #35 Bucyk, 37 Delvecchio, 84 Mahovlich, and 131 Parent also receiving the MINT assessment. Every other card in the set is graded PSA 8. It should be noted that the Gordie Howe card has never graded GEM MINT with PSA, making this PSA 9 example the highest graded on record with the California grading company.
